Responsive Vimeo

The video is made responsive by entering the file width and height, setting the maximum width and entering the video ID. The code takes care of the rest.
There are options for autoplay and loop but these should not be used for responsive web pages which will be viewed on mobile phones.
There's an "Auto Pause" control which should be used if more than one Vimeo video is inserted on the page so that one stops when the next is played.
There are controls for showing the portrait, badge, byline and title if these have been added to the source video.
Although there is an option for a fullscreen control, it should only be used if the video quality is good enough.
The heading and this text are optional but they should be used to insert the video title and a description of the video's content using keywords for the search engines.
The widget can have a border and/or a box shadow added. When a shadow is used, the video width is reduced slightly so that it will show on mobile devices. The vertical spacing control should be set to at least the same value as the shadow radius.
